Introduction
We are pleased to release the new FLY-Pi V2 mainboard. This board has the same installation dimensions as the Raspberry Pi and can replace the Raspberry Pi as a mainboard, featuring 1GB of onboard DDR3 memory, allowing it to run a full LINUX desktop (based on Armbian custom optimization). The board can be used with Klipper and RRF firmware, and even runs the Klipper screen when using the SHT tool board. The purpose of designing this mainboard is to make it easier for customers to use Klipper firmware or RRF firmware. We have optimized the LINUX system image to be more suitable for 3D printers, with simpler operation and installation, making it easy for beginners with some basic knowledge to quickly learn how to use it. Compared to other mainboard boards, it reduces learning costs, allowing you to focus more on enjoying the joy of 3D printing (buying a package with an SD card pre-installed with Klipper firmware, power-on ready, saving time and effort).
Features
- Same form factor as Raspberry Pi 3B and 4B
- CPU: High-performance Allwinner H5 chip, quad-core 64-bit Cortex-A53
- GPU: High-performance 6-core Mali 450, pixel fill rate greater than 2.7gpixel/s
- RAM: 1GB DDR3 (shared with GPU) (512+512)
- ROM: Supports up to 128GB SD card
- Peripherals: Spi x2, UART x2, USB x4 (USB 2.0 x3, OTG x1), Micro HDMI x1, Eth x1 (100M), CAN (onboard USB-to-CAN module, i.e., onboard UTOC)
- Interfaces: Onboard M.2 interface, expandable WIFI, eMMC, etc. (proprietary protocol, do not connect non-FLY π dedicated M.2 devices)
- 40Pin interface, compatible with Raspberry Pi
- Supports 12-24V DC power supply, more stable power supply *预留了一个5V风扇ZH1.5接口
- Pre-installed with klipper, moonraker, mainsail, fulidd, klipper-screen, Crowsmest, resonance compensation plugins numpy and FLY-Tools, no need for complex operations like changing sources, making it easier for beginners (requires purchase of TF card or M2WE)
